Non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(DHGNA) é uma preocupação crescente de saúde global, afetando aproximadamente 25% of the population. It encompasses a spectrum of liver conditions, ranging from simple steatosis to more severe forms such as non-alc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H), fibrose, cirrose, and hepatocellular carcinoma. Atualmente, there is no cure for NAFLD, and treatment options are limited to lifestyle modifications and pharmacological interventions that often have limited efficacy. Stem cell therapy has emerged as a promising therapeutic approach for NAFLD due to its potential to regenerate damaged liver tissue and restore liver function.

Stem Cell Therapy for Non-Alcoholic Fatty Liver Disease: Situação Atual e Direções Futuras

Stem cell therapy involves the transplantation of stem cells into the liver to repair or replace damaged tissue. Preclinical studies have demonstrated the potential of stem cells to differentiate into hepatocytes, colangiócitos, e outros tipos de células do fígado, contributing to liver regeneration and functional improvement. Em ensaios clínicos, stem cell therapy has shown promising results in reducing liver inflammation, fibrose, and steatosis, and improving liver function in patients with NAFLD. No entanto, mais pesquisas são necessárias para otimizar os métodos de entrega de células-tronco, enhance cell engraftment and survival, e abordar possíveis preocupações de segurança.

Potential Applications and Challenges of Stem Cell-Based Interventions in NAFLD

Stem cell-based interventions hold great promise for the treatment of NAFLD. Potential applications include:

  • Liver regeneration: As células-tronco podem se diferenciar em hepatócitos, as células funcionais primárias do fígado, to replace damaged or lost cells.
  • Efeitos antiinflamatórios: Stem cells secrete anti-inflammatory cytokines that can reduce liver inflammation, a key driver of NAFLD progression.
  • Anti-fibrotic effects: Stem cells can inhibit the formation of scar tissue (fibrose) in the liver, which can lead to cirrhosis and liver failure.

No entanto, several challenges need to be addressed before stem cell therapy can be widely adopted for NAFLD treatment. Estes incluem:

  • Cell delivery: Finding the most effective and efficient way to deliver stem cells to the liver is crucial for successful therapy.
  • Cell engraftment and survival: Ensuring that stem cells successfully integrate into the liver and survive long-term is essential for sustained therapeutic effects.
  • Safety concerns: Stem cell therapy must be safe and free from adverse effects, como formação de tumor ou rejeição imunológica.
